Casement windows have acquired popularity amongst house owners due to their style, functionality, and energy effectiveness. A casement window is hinged on one side, enabling it to swing open like a door, offering outstanding ventilation and unobstructed views. Common Types of Casement Windows
Understanding the numerous types of casement windows available can aid property owners in their selection procedure. Below is a list of typical types:
Standard Residential Casement Window Installer Windows: Hinged on one side, opening external with a crank manage.
Awning Windows: Similar to casement windows but hinged at the top, these windows open outside from the bottom, permitting for ventilation even throughout rain.
Mix Windows: A mix of different window designs, where casement windows are coupled with repaired or moving windows for visual appeal.
Corner Casement Windows: Installed at the corner of a home, supplying breathtaking views and special architectural styles.
Frequently asked questions1. How long does the installation of casement windows usually take?
The installation duration can vary based upon the number of windows being replaced, but most jobs can be finished within a day or 2.
2. Are casement windows energy-efficient?
Yes, casement windows are typically thought about energy-efficient due to their tight seal when closed, lowering air leakage.
3. What is the typical cost of casement windows?
Cost differs based upon materials, style, and local labor markets. On average, house owners can anticipate to pay between 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window.
4. Can I set up casement windows myself?
While DIY installation is possible, it is not advised unless you are Experienced Window Installer in window installation. Professional professionals guarantee correct sealing and compliance with codes.
5. What upkeep do casement windows require?
Routine upkeep includes inspecting seals, cleaning up the frames and glass, and guaranteeing the opening system functions smoothly.
